CHRISTIAN RELATIONSHIPS
As a minister's daughter, I met people from all religions, from all walks of life, from all cultures who had different customs, different views on life, as well as different religious beliefs.
The one thing that stuck in my Learning Bank was the fact that even Christians are cranky at times, or they are short in temper, or a bit too swift with their tongues. It was an important lesson in life.
Everyone from time-to-time isn't going to be their best.
I once saw a short clip where a wife burned her hand while cooking breakfast. Her husband walked in, all nice and happy, and she yelled at him when he greeted her. It was an instant balloon-popper. In turn, as he was going to his car to drive to work, the milkman passed by (yes, it was a long time ago, wasn't it??), and the man yelled at him about how he was setting the milk too far out on the porch in the sun's grasp. The milkman went home, then jumped on his wife, who then yelled at the innocent cat.
The purpose of the short clip was to illustrate that anger is contagious.
The next time that you experience anger from someone you meet, give them a little room. Odds are, they are having a really bad day, or things in their private life are taking their toll. It's very hard to smile in the face of anger, but as long as the 'O Angered One' doesn't haul off and knock all your front teeth out, they'll probably appreciate your understanding - and in turn, you will be breaking the cycle of anger.
